网站推广.NET

网站推广.NET

PHP网站视频加载慢怎么办

来源:互联网

PHP网站视频加载慢可能是由多种原因造成的,下面是一些可能的解决方法:

1. 优化视频文件:确保视频文件的大小适中,尽量减少视频的文件大小,可以通过压缩视频文件、选择正确的视频格式等方式来实现。

2. 配置服务器:检查服务器配置,确保服务器具备足够的带宽,可以根据需求进行升级,以提高网站视频加载速度。

3. 使用内容分发网络(CDN):使用CDN服务来分发视频内容,可以将视频文件缓存在全球各地的服务器中,从而提高用户的访问速度。

4. 压缩和缓存:使用压缩和缓存技术,将视频文件压缩并缓存到用户浏览器的本地存储中,实现视频的快速加载。

5. 使用流媒体服务器:使用流媒体服务器来处理视频的传输和播放,流媒体服务器可以根据用户的网络环境自动调整视频的质量和码率,以提高用户的观看体验。

6. 使用预加载技术:通过预加载视频相关的资源,如视频缓存、播放器等,可以在用户点击播放按钮之前提前加载视频,以减少用户等待时间。

7. 优化网站代码:检查网站的代码,优化数据库查询、减少HTTP请求、合并和压缩CSS和JavaScript文件等,以提高网站整体的加载速度。

8. 测试和监测:定期对网站进行性能测试和监测,及时发现和解决视频加载慢的问题,保持网站的流畅访问。

总结起来,优化视频文件、配置服务器、使用CDN、压缩和缓存、使用流媒体服务器、使用预加载技术、优化网站代码、测试和监测等方法可以帮助提高PHP网站视频加载速度。根据具体情况选择合适的方法来解决问题。

PHP网站视频加载慢可能有多种原因,以下是一些解决方法:

1. 使用适当的视频格式:选择适当的视频格式可以大大影响加载速度。常见的视频格式包括MP4、WebM和Ogg。MP4是最常用的视频格式,因为它具有广泛的兼容性,但它可能会导致加载速度较慢。WebM和Ogg则是具有更高压缩比的视频格式,可以提供更快的加载速度。使用适当的视频编解码器和压缩工具也可以加快加载速度。

2. 压缩视频文件:压缩视频文件可以减小文件大小,从而减少加载时间。可以使用视频压缩工具(如FFmpeg)来压缩视频文件。压缩视频文件时需要注意保持视频质量的同时减小文件大小。

3. 使用流式传输:使用流式传输可以实现视频的快速加载。流式传输是指在视频加载时,同时播放视频的一部分内容。这样可以在视频加载的同时让用户观看已加载的部分,提高用户体验。

4. 使用内容分发网络(CDN):使用CDN可以将视频分发到离用户更近的服务器上,从而减少加载时间。cdn服务器通常位于全球各个地区,可以根据用户的地理位置选择最近的服务器来提供视频内容,提高加载速度。

5. 优化服务器配置:优化服务器配置可以提高服务器的响应速度和处理能力。可以通过增加服务器的带宽和内存、使用缓存来减少对服务器的请求次数、优化数据库查询等方法来改善服务器性能。

注意:以上方法可能需要您具备一定的技术知识,如果您对服务器和编程不太了解,建议咨询专业技术人员进行帮助和指导。

PHP网站视频加载慢可能是由多种原因引起的,如服务器带宽限制、视频文件过大、网络延迟等。下面是一些解决方法和操作流程来优化PHP网站视频加载速度:

1. 优化视频文件:
– 尽量选择适度的视频分辨率和比特率,以减小视频文件的大小。
– 使用H.264编码以提高视频的压缩效率。
– 如果可能,使用流媒体服务器来分割和传输视频,以提供更快的加载速度。

2. 使用缓存:
– 首先,启用服务器端缓存,如使用HTTP缓存头来告诉浏览器缓存视频文件。
– 其次,在PHP代码中使用缓存机制来存储已经解析和处理过的视频数据,并在下一次请求时直接使用缓存数据。
– 最后,借助浏览器缓存,设置适当的Expires和Cache-Control头来控制视频文件的缓存时间。

3. 使用CDN:
– 使用内容分发网络(CDN)来分发视频文件,通过在全球多个服务器上存储视频文件副本,能够加快视频加载速度。
– 许多CDN提供商提供API和工具来集成CDN服务到PHP应用程序中。

4. 对服务器进行优化:
– 提高服务器带宽,可以通过升级你的服务器方案,如选择更高带宽的虚拟主机或独立服务器。
– 配置服务器,使用压缩算法来减小传输的数据量。
– 调整网络传输参数和服务器配置,以提高服务器的整体性能。

5. 对网站结构进行优化:
– 使用懒加载技术,先加载网页内容,再加载视频文件,提高整体加载速度。
– 使用缩略图代替实际视频,在用户点击缩略图时再动态加载视频。

总结:
优化PHP网站视频加载速度的方法有很多,以上提到的方法只是其中一部分。在实际情况中,可以根据具体的需求和情况选择适合的优化方法。另外,定期检查视频加载速度和性能,以及使用工具来分析和监控网站性能,也是提高PHP网站视频加载速度的关键。

视频慢